We have some cool images to share with you guys. Some digital artists with a great deal of time and talent on their hands decided to create this visual comparison of three of the hottest flagship smartphones. Two of these are created using the leaks, rumors and speculation surrounding the "as yet unreleased" devices.

As you can see in the image above (and more in the thread below) we have the HTC One M9, the Samsung Galaxy S6 and the Apple iPhone 6 facing off in a glamour-style modeling competition. In the first shot shown (above) the devices are labeled incorrectly, but we are pretty confident you can tell them apart accurately.
